Doreen Boxer is a Criminal Law Certified Specialist with 23 years of legal experience, in trial and appellate court, and has practiced  in state and federal jurisdictions. She is a member of the Bar in New York, Massachusetts, California and several federal jurisdictions.

Ms. Boxer is widely known for being a thorough and creative litigator dedicated to helping her clients reach their goals. She earned her B.S. in 1986 at New York University’s Stern School of Business, her J.D. in 1989 at Yeshiva University’s Cardozo School of Law, and attended Harvard University’s Kennedy School of Government where she earned a Certificate in Senior Executives in State and Local Government in 2007. Ms. Boxer is a published author, columnist, and has been a television commentator on legal issues.

 


Robert McLaughlin is a partner at Boxer McLaughlin, APC. Mr. McLaughlin has been an attorney for 23 years, and has litigated many high profile, multi-million dollar complex civil litigation matters, divorces, and child custody/visitation disputes. Mr. McLaughlin earned his B.A. at University of Massachusetts/Amherst in 1986 and his J.D. at Boston College Law School in 1989. In addition, Mr. McLaughlin has conducted more than one hundred civil,criminal, family law and dependency appeals.
